Two officials in former President Barack Obama’s administration, including ex-acting U.S. Attorney General Sally Yates, will testify on Monday in a Senate investigation into allegations of Russian meddling in the 2016 U.S. election and possible collusion between President Donald Trump’s campaign and Moscow.
